Ventilator Pressure Support: What You Required to Know for Ideal Client Care
Ventilator stress assistance (VPS) describes a mode of mechanical ventilation where the ventilator assists the patient's spontaneous breaths by supplying a pre-programmed level of inspiratory pressure. This method is made largely for individuals that have some ability to initiate breaths however call for support as a result of damaged respiratory system muscles or various other underlying conditions.

The Essentials of Ventilator Stress Support
What Is Ventilator Support?
Ventilator support encompasses different methods utilized by healthcare professionals to help patients requiring respiratory help. This includes VPS, Continual Positive Air Passage Stress (CPAP), and Assist-Control (AC) settings among others.
How Does VPS Work?
When a patient initiates a breathing initiative, the ventilator discovers this activity thanks to its sensitive triggers. It then delivers a preset amount of stress during inspiration, ensuring that the person gets enough air flow without having to function exceedingly hard.
Key Components of VPS
Pressure Settings: The level at which the ventilator aids the patient's breath. Trigger Sensitivity: The responsiveness of the ventilator in identifying person efforts. Cycle Termination: The requirements utilized by the ventilator to figure out when inspiration ought to end. PEEP (Positive End Expiratory Pressure): Maintains air passage patency and stops alveolar collapse at end-expiration.Indications for Utilizing Ventilator Stress Support
When Is VPS Indicated?
VPS is shown in a number of scientific situations:
-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) exacerbations Neuromuscular problems influencing respiratory muscles Post-operative individuals calling for short-term support Patients with extreme pneumonia or ARDS (Severe Respiratory System Distress Syndrome)
Assessing Client Needs
Determining whether VPS is ideal calls for comprehensive clinical assessment, consisting of:
- Evaluating arterial blood gas (ABG) results Monitoring crucial signs Assessing breathing mechanics
Advantages and Downsides of VPS
Benefits of Ventilator Pressure Support
Improved Comfort: Individuals frequently find VPS more comfortable than typical invasive ventilation. Reduced Sedation Needs: Lots of clients have the ability to work together far better during treatment. Preservation of Breathing Muscle Function: Enables some level of spontaneous effort. Easier Weaning Process: Progressive reduction in support promotes weaning off mechanical ventilation.Potential Drawbacks
Risk of Hyperventilation: Unsuitable settings may bring about excessive ventilation. Patient-Ventilator Asynchrony: Inequality in between patient demands and machine reactions can cause discomfort. Increased Workload if Not Kept Track Of Properly: Calls for ongoing evaluation by experienced professionals.Training Opportunities for Health care Professionals
